Q4 Planning Note — Supplier Renewal

Quick update for the board: our contract with Kettleford Components comes up for renewal in November, and we're inclined to extend for two years rather than one. Their pricing held flat through the metals squeeze, and switching to Averlane Industrial would mean a six-month qualification cycle we can't really afford. We've asked for a volume rebate tier and flexible delivery windows for the Marsden facility. Legal is reviewing terms now. The confidential note below sets out where this fits in our wider plans.

board note of kageg-bahof: The renewal with Holwynax Holdings closes at $2 million a year, 5 percent below the last contract. Project Ulaath slips by two quarters because of the supplier delay.

## Shuttle-Bus Gate — Harrowfield Campus

Gate 4 serves the Mirabel Loop shuttle only. Opens 06:40–19:20 weekdays. No pedestrian traffic; direct walkers to the Ashvale Lobby. Drivers swipe in; escorts swipe out. If the reader fails, log it with the Kestrel Facilities queue before overriding. Manual release lever is for emergencies only and triggers an alarm. Use the code below for manual gate override.

staff pass of kagup-fajog = bdg-QCHVQW-99665837

// MAX_GRAPH_DEPTH limits traversal in the Lattixview dependency
// graph visualizer. Security note: this cap prevents adversarial
// manifests from forcing unbounded recursion and exhausting the
// render worker. Raising it requires review, since deep graphs are
// fetched from untrusted package metadata. The value was tuned
// against the audit corpus built under the token noted below.

build token for kagaf-hahof: htk14_9d3d4d26d7d8de

## Idempotency Keys for Payment Retries (Lumopay)

Every retry of a charge request must reuse the original idempotency key; generating a new key on retry can produce duplicate charges. Keys are scoped per merchant and expire after 48 hours. Reviewers should verify keys are derived server-side, never from client input. The full key-generation specification and threat model are maintained on the internal page.

dashboard of kaguf-tawip = https://vault.merlaqsys.test/issue